Austrian born, Eichmann was an early member of the Nazis SS. Eichmann became the man responsible within the SS for the "Final Solution of the Jewish Problem," the annihilation of European Jewry. After the war, Eichmann escaped from US forces and made his way to Argentina. In 1961, Israeli Mossad agents apprehended him and brought him to Israel for trial. In 1962, he was tried, convicted for his crimes against the Jewish people, and hung. Eichmann was the only individual ever to be executed by the State of Israel, after trial.
